U+0315 "̕" Combining Comma Above Right is a diacritical mark used in the International Phonetic Alphabet and certain linguistic notations to represent modifications in pronunciation, most notably as part of the representation of ejective consonants when placed above a letter. This combining character is designed to attach to the top right of a base character, slightly offset from a standard comma, and is often applied to indicate a sharp, released burst of air or a secondary articulation. In digital text, it must follow the base character it modifies, relying on proper font rendering to appear correctly positioned above and to the right of the preceding glyph.
